Behind the Stickered Walls

Tucked around the back of New Street station’s metallic shell, Bonehead Birmingham serves straightforward American comfort food where heavy metal and rock riffs fill the air. Black painted surfaces and layers of venue stickers create a gritty backdrop for casual dining. This unpretentious spot recently earned a Local Gem designation from The Good Food Guide, largely because it draws frequent visits from top local chefs who appreciate its focused menu and lively service. Guests arrive for walk-ins only, settling into a room that prioritizes loud music and messy plates over formal rituals.

Southern Fire and Buttermilk

The kitchen builds every dish around a custom southern style seasoning that anchors their buttermilk fried chicken. Pieces, tenders, and thighs get coated and fried until crisp, then tossed through distinct flavor profiles like the Nashville inspired Hot Head or the Tennessee style Lizard King glaze. Bourbon and brown sugar mingle with crispy shallots to transform the latter into a smoky sandwich staple when pressed onto buns alongside white slaw. Each batch relies on careful frying techniques rather than complicated sauces, letting the spice blends carry the weight.

Plates Built for Sharing

Diners typically start with platters of wings dressed in sriracha honey butter or zesty lemon herb seasoning before moving to loaded sides. Waffle fries arrive piled high with house slaw, gherkins, and a tangy comeback sauce that ties the whole meal together. Burger orders cycle through the Dragon variant featuring kewpie mayo and sesame, or the classic Buffalo version paired with blue cheese dip. Every component leans toward bold, accessible flavors designed for hands on eating and quick turnover between sets.

The Good Food Guide — Local Gem

A favourite among some of Birmingham’s top chefs (Aktar Islam from Opheem is a well-known fan), this spot tucked around the back of New Street station’s hulking metallic shell is the place for getting your hands dirty. Black-painted, heavily stickered walls and a heavy metal/rock soundtrack set the tone for some outrageously good buttermilk fried chicken (tenders, thighs, breast, etc) with punchy seasonings. Otherwise, choose a platter of wings or one of the chicken burgers ('hothead', buffalo', 'lizard king') and, if appetite allows, add a side of waffle fries piled with coleslaw, gherkins and their signature ‘comeback sauce’. Service is fun and friendly and, happily, wet wipes are delivered with the bill. Cashless; walk-ins only.
